5. Affiliate links

Madealert participates in the eBay Partner Network. When you click "View on eBay" in a deal alert email or push notification, the destination link includes affiliate tracking parameters (such as campid and customid).

If you make a qualifying purchase on eBay within their attribution window (typically 24 hours after clicking), we may earn a small commission from eBay. This is at no additional cost to you — eBay pays us out of their own margin, not by charging you more.

We do not share your personal identity with eBay. The customid parameter is an internal alert identifier (a random UUID) — not your name, email, or account ID. eBay receives only the click event tied to that UUID for commission attribution purposes.
